The Detroit Foundation Hotel has transformed the historic Detroit Fire Department Headquarters into a 100‑room independent hotel that adds another piece to the ongoing Detroit renaissance puzzle. It draws on the Motor‑City’s unparalleled past while proactively moving the city to its next incarnation as a national cultural, business and artistic touch‑point. Featuring an inviting ground‑floor restaurant, The Apparatus Room, the hotel partners with local distillers, brewers, farmer’s and other edible sundry purveyors to deliver and authentic Detroit experience.

Aparium, founded in 2011, was driven by the belief that all hospitality experiences should be fueled by the poetics of their surroundings. It has grown into a new kind of hotel brand, one that ventures off the beaten path, both geographically and philosophically, combining the business acumen of large hospitality companies with the charm of boutique hotels.
